首页 资讯文章正文

Vue技术驱动下的高效网站生成,构建现代Web体验的利器,Vue赋能,打造高效网站,引领现代Web体验新潮流

资讯 2025年05月30日 09:36 49 admin
Vue技术以其高效性推动网站生成,助力构建现代Web体验,通过简洁易用的框架,Vue助力开发者快速实现高性能网站,提升用户体验,成为现代Web开发不可或缺的利器。

随着互联网技术的飞速发展,网站已经成为企业展示形象、拓展业务的重要平台,在这个信息爆炸的时代,如何快速、高效地生成一个既美观又实用的网站,成为了许多企业和开发者的迫切需求,Vue.js,作为一款流行的前端框架,以其简洁的语法、高效的性能和强大的社区支持,成为了构建现代Web网站的首选技术,本文将探讨Vue如何助力开发者生成网站,并提供一些建议和最佳实践。

Vue简介

Vue.js(读音 /vjuː/,类似于 view)是一个用于构建用户界面的渐进式JavaScript框架,它由尤雨溪(Evan You)于2014年创建,并迅速在国内外开发者中获得了广泛的关注,Vue的核心库只关注视图层,易于上手,同时也易于与其他库或已有项目整合,Vue的核心理念是“数据驱动”,通过双向数据绑定,实现了视图和数据的同步更新,极大地提高了开发效率和用户体验。

Vue生成网站的优势

易于上手

Vue的语法简洁明了,文档齐全,新手可以快速上手,Vue拥有丰富的社区资源,如教程、插件和工具等,为开发者提供了强大的支持。

高效性能

Vue采用虚拟DOM(Virtual DOM)技术,实现了视图和数据的分离,从而提高了渲染性能,在处理大量数据时,Vue可以快速计算出最优的DOM更新策略,减少不必要的DOM操作,提高页面响应速度。

组件化开发

Vue支持组件化开发,可以将网站拆分为多个可复用的组件,这种开发模式提高了代码的可维护性和可扩展性,使得网站开发更加高效。

跨平台支持

Vue可以与各种后端技术结合,如Node.js、Spring Boot等,实现前后端分离,Vue还可以用于移动端开发,如通过Vue Native等技术实现跨平台应用。

强大的生态系统

Vue拥有丰富的生态系统,包括路由管理器Vue Router、状态管理库Vuex、构建工具Webpack等,这些工具和库可以帮助开发者快速搭建和优化网站。

Vue生成网站的步骤

创建项目

使用Vue CLI(命令行工具)可以快速创建一个Vue项目,通过命令vue create my-project,可以选择预设配置或自定义配置,生成项目结构。

设计页面布局

根据需求设计页面布局,可以使用HTML和CSS进行静态页面开发,Vue支持响应式布局,可以根据不同设备自动调整页面样式。

编写Vue组件

将页面拆分为多个组件,如头部、导航、内容、尾部等,在组件中,使用Vue的数据绑定、事件处理等特性实现交互功能。

状态管理

对于复杂的业务逻辑,可以使用Vuex进行状态管理,Vuex提供了集中式存储管理所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化。

路由管理

使用Vue Router进行页面路由管理,实现单页面应用(SPA)的效果,通过配置路由,可以实现页面跳转、参数传递等功能。

优化与部署

在开发过程中,可以使用Webpack等工具进行代码压缩、合并等优化操作,完成后,将项目部署到服务器或云平台,即可访问网站。

Vue生成网站的最佳实践

保持组件的单一职责

每个组件应专注于实现单一功能,避免过度耦合。

使用组件插槽(slot)

插槽可以灵活地复用组件,实现更复杂的布局。

遵循Vue官方文档的最佳实践

Vue官方文档提供了丰富的最佳实践,如组件命名规范、代码组织等。

利用Vue插件和工具

Vue拥有丰富的插件和工具,如Element UI、Vuetify等,可以帮助开发者快速搭建美观、实用的网站。

关注性能优化

对网站进行性能优化,如懒加载、代码分割等,提高用户体验。

Vue.js作为一款强大的前端框架,为开发者提供了高效、便捷的网站生成方案,通过Vue,开发者可以快速构建出美观、实用的现代Web网站,掌握Vue技术,将有助于你在Web开发领域脱颖而出。

标签: Vue 高效网站

上海衡基裕网络科技有限公司,网络热门最火问答,www.tdkwl.com网络技术服务,技术服务,技术开发,技术交流 备案号:沪ICP备2023039794号 内容仅供参考 本站内容均来源于网络,如有侵权,请联系我们删除QQ:597817868